Music promoter calls for creative sector commercialisation

01 Dec 2022

Proper structures and solutions to commercialise the creative sector will enable women in the creative space to get recognition.

It was on such backdrop that legendary music promoter, Zenzele Hirschfeld, called on government and other relevant authorities to put in place proper structures in the creative industry as well as a system that would govern the entertainment industry to commercialise it.

Hirschfeld made the call at the women in song workshop in Gaborone on Tuesday.

The workshop was part of the Botswana Music and Entertainment Week (BMEW) activities ahead of the Botswana Music Union (BOMU) awards scheduled for tomorrow.

“The creative industry in Botswana, which is at its infancy, is starting to show signs of progress as more women are taking space in the leading roles. Back in the days the local entertainment space was male dominated,” Hirschfeld said.

However, she said women were still faced with challenges in the industry saying ‘sometimes beauty surpassed intelligence.’

She, therefore, urged women to double efforts if they were to be successful in the industry and match their male counterparts.

Sharing the same sentiments was singer and songwriter, Mpho Sebina who called for policies and laws that would protect women in the creative industry.

“Females often get sidelined over their male colleagues when it comes to bookings as well as payments which often are delayed on their side,” Sebina said.

As such, she challenged women in music to claim their space in the production side of things so to close the already existing gap.

“The industry is engulfed by males, therefore women in song need to invest in recording equipment and learn the art of producing to be on par with their male colleagues,” she added.

Additionally, Sebina implored women colleagues to invest in building teams as a means to commercialise their craft.

“Building a team is important as it allows a creative to focus on your craft whilst other duties that enhance performance and product are carried out by other experts in the field,” she said.

She, further, encouraged them to align themselves with people they trusted as well as those who loved and understood them. ENDS
